Congratulations to the Boys Tennis Team who, after posting a 7-2 league record, finished
in 2nd place for the first time since 2008. Despite the rainouts of the league finales, it was determined that since they
mathematically would not affect the final standings, they would not be re-scheduled. Compiling a 14-3 overall record,
the Pilots now await the team's fate and news from the CIF seeding committee as to whether or not the team has qualified for
the Division I team playoffs. In other
news, the Pilots are happy to announce that 6 of the team's starters have been selected to play in the 6th Annual Marine League
Singles & Doubles Championships. In singles, Jorge Zavala earned the #2 seed in the tournament, and will face off
vs. the #3 singles player from Narbonne, who is the #7 seed. Jonathan Guray just made the cut, and as the #8 seed will
take on Narbonne's #1 player, and the #1 seed in the tournament. Daunting as the task may seem, Guray needs to look no further
than last year when teammate Jorge Zavala upset the #2 seed, as the #7 seed in the tournament. In doubles, Michael Gonzalez
& JoseAngel Sotelo are the #2 seeds, and will face off against their own teammates, Fernando Corona & Esteban Zavala,
who are the #7 seeds. Up for grabs, is
not only the title of league champ, but an automatic entry into the CIF LA City Section Singles & Doubles Championships.
Out of over 24 singles players & at least 36 doubles players in the league, the top 8 singles players, and the top
